Below we detail Briefly the 3 Parts needed to become an approved Driving Instructor.
Initial registration
You can apply for this Starter registration pack on line at Registration on line this pack contains the DSA registration and CRB (Criminal Record Bureau) Checks application.
Please be aware that to be accepted onto the Register of Approved Driving Instructors (ADIs) if you hold a full UK or European Union (EU)/European Economic Area (EEA) unrestricted car driving licence, have held it for a total of at least four out of the past six years prior to entering the ADI Register after qualifying, and you have not have been disqualified from driving at any time in the four years prior to being entered in the register.
Part1 Theory
The driving Instructors Theory Test.
The current part 1 is a multiple choice entry exam a large proportion of study can be undertaken at home, we can supply you with the necessary training materials as well as classroom tutorials
Part 2 Practical
The Test of Driving Ability
You will be trained practically with the use of our part 2 syllabus to improve your driving skills. All aspects of your driving will be assessed. Your Training will be thorough to ensure your driving to the high level of which is expected to pass the Part 2 driving test. This is not an easy test and requires that old Bad habits are corrected and your driving must be technically perfect.
Part 3 Instructional Test
The Driving Instructor’s Test of Instructional Ability
The third - and final - part of the Approved Driving Instructor (ADI) qualifying examination will assess your ability to give effective instruction. We suggest you visit the following link to give indepth information on what is required to pass the part 3 Examination.
